Villain is 22/0/0.5 over 31 hands, so he is basically an unknown at this point. When I got min-raised on the turn I called, planning to c/c a reasonable river bet on a safe card. Villain then overbets the river… there goes my plan… I tend to find an unknown min raising the turn on a paired board is a pretty strong line. I guess to fold I have to assume this opponent limps AA/QQ utg and doesn’t raise a set on a monotone flop :s… Bigger flush is a more likely possibility maybe. Fold/call?
